Carrying out checks

After completing the checks, carry out the thermal insulation to
complete the work.
All screws tightened on the installation set?
Collector clamps fitted and screws tightened?
Solar hoses secured with hose clips (circlip tightened)?
Tightness test carried out and all connections checked for
leaks?
Secure positioning of the installation set, collector and
storage tank checked?
Potable water and solar circuits filled?
Pressure relief valves installed?

Insulating the connection lines and pipework

▶ Thermally insulate the on-site external pipework using material that
is resistant to UV rays, weather influences and high temperatures
(150 °C).
▶ Insulate internal pipework with high temperature-resistant (150 °C)
material.
▶ Protect the insulation against damage from birds if required.
▶ Observe local conditions (e.g. sand).

Environmental protection, shutdown, disposal
WARNING:
Risk to life from falling from roof!
▶ Never use a ladder to move components to the roof because the
installation material and collectors are heavy and difficult to handle.
▶ Whilst working on the roof, take all necessary precautions against a
possible fall.
▶ If there is not any independent anti-fall safety device, wear personal
protective equipment.

Shutdown

WARNING:
Risk of scalding from hot water!
▶ Let the DHW cylinder cool down sufficiently.
▶ Drain the storage tank and pipework.
▶ Shut down all assemblies and accessories of the heating system as
specified by the manufacturer.
▶ Close the shut-off valves.
▶ Drain the heat exchanger completely, in the event of frost. Also in the
bottom part of the storage tank.
To prevent corrosion:
▶ Leave the cover of the inspection aperture open so that the interior of
the storage tank can dry completely.
Removing and disposing
▶ Drain the pipework.
▶ Undo the collector clamps on the side and in between collectors.
▶ Remove connection pipes.
▶ Use aids for transport ( Transport).
▶ Dispose of components by environmentally friendly means.
